Dear Colonel Davidson:

   We have made a review for the settlement  of the accounts of
certifying officers at the Kentucky State Headquarters,  Selective
Service System, Frankfort, Kentucky for the period  January 3, 1965
to December 31, 1970.  Our review, completed  in February 1971, was made
pursuant to the Budget and Accounting Act,  1921 (31 U.S.C. 53) and the
Accounting and Auditing Act of 1950 (31 U.S.C.  67).

   Each agency has the basic responsibility  for proper accounting
and internal control to provide assurance  of the legality, propriety,
and correctness of disbursements and collection  of public funds.  Since
the accounting function for your office was  transferred to the Regional
Center, Atlanta, Georgia, effective January  1, 1971, our review of the
accounting and internal controls was  limited.  However, we made such
tests of transactions as we deemed  appropriate and considered the
report of the most recent audit by  the National Headquarters Field
Auditor in setting the  scope of our review. We  did not examine program-
type operations.

   Our review disclosed that  the administrative procedures and controls
were generally  satisfactory.

   In accordance with 8  GAO 13 the records of transactions through
December 31, 1970 may be  transmitted to the Federal Records Center for
storage in accordance with your records management  program.

   Three copies of this report  are being sent to the Director, Selective
Service System, Washington,  D.C.

   We wish to acknowledge  the cooperation given our representatives
during the review.
